The Roadies Winner Name of all Season is Here

Season Year Tittle Winners Prize money
1 2003 NA Rannvijay Singh ₹5,00,000
2 2004 NA Ayushmann Khurrana ₹5,00,000
3 2005 NA Parul Shahi ₹3,60,000
4 2006–07 NA Anthony Yeh ₹3,75,500
5 2007–08 Roadies 5.0 Ashutosh Kaushik ₹2,30,000
6 2008–09 Roadies Hell Down Under Nauman Sait ₹3,62,000
7 2009–10 Roadies:7 Deadly Sins & 1 Wild Safari Anwar Syed ₹90,000
8 2011 Roadies 8: Shortcut to Hell Aanchal Khurana ₹4,00,000
9 2012 Roadies 9: Everything or Nothing Vikas Khoker ₹6,17,000
10 2013 Roadies X: Battle for Glory Palak Johal ₹4,50,000
11 2014 Roadies X1: Ride for Respect Nikhil Sachdeva ₹3,20,000
12 2015 Roadies X2: Your Road, Your Gang Prince Narula ₹5,00,000
14 2016 Roadies X4: Your Gang, Your Glory Balraj Singh Khehra Renault Duster
15 2017 Roadies Rising Shweta Mehta Renault Duster
16 2018 Roadies Xtreme Kashish Thakur Renault Duster
17 2019 Roadies: Real Heroes Arun Sharma Droom Used Super Bike

Roadies Season 1 Winner Name 2003: Rannvijay Singh Singha

The first-ever season of this tremendous show was started in the year 2003, where the winner who holds first place in the show and grabs the trophy of the show was Rannvijay Singh Singha. Ranvijay is an Indian actor, anchor, television represented, host, and a very well-known personality of the Bollywood industry. After winning the first season, he hosting this amazing show from 2004 to 2014.

Roadies Season 2 winner name 2004: Ayushman Khurana

The second season was won by the famous personality of Bollywood named Ayushman Khurrana who grabs first place in the 2004 season. He is an Indian actor, anchor, poet, singer, television represented and many more, also, he won many awards along with two Filmfare Awards.

Roadies season 3 Winner Name 2005: Parul Shahi

The third season was started on 11th November 2005, where the contestant who won the title of the show is Parul Shahi and grabs the title of first female roadies from Delhi.

Roadies Season 4 Winner Name 2006: Anthony Yeh

The fourth Season title was won by Anthony Yeh and he was the one who grabs the trophy for the 2006 season and the show was hosted by first season winner Ranvijay, who announced the winner of the show.

Roadies Season 5 Winner Name 2007: Ashutosh Kaushik

The fifth season was started on 22nd March 2007 where the contestants Ashutosh Kaushik won the title of the show by securing first place on the show. After that, he participates in Bigg Boss in the year 2008 where he again grabs the first position of the show.

Roadies Season 6 Winner Name 2009 (Hell Down Under): Nauman Sait

The sixth season’s first episode was telecasted on 8th November 2009, where Nauman Sait announced as the winner of the show and grabs the winning amount of 3,62,000.

Roadies Season 7 Winner Name 2010 (Hell Down Under): Anwar Syed

The amazing and fantastic seventh season was first telecasted on 28th March 2010, where the participant Anwar Syed grabs the winning trophy and in the history of roadies the shoot was done in three countries such as India, Kenya, and Egypt.

Roadies Season 8 Winner Name 2011 (Shortcut to Hell): Aanchal Khurana

The second lady winner of the roadies came out in the eighth season, where the contender named Aanchal Khurana grabs the winning trophy, and also, she was the other lady who belongs from Delhi.

Roadies Season 9 Winner Name 2012 (Everything or Nothing): Vikas Khoker

The ninth season was first aired on 7th January 2012, where the contestant who defeated the 13 contestants and grabs the title of the show is Vikas Choker. He is the winner of the ninth Season title named Everything or Nothing.

Roadies Season 10 Winner Name 2013 (Battle for Glory): Palak Johal

The tremendous tenth season was won by Palak Johal who emerged as the strongest contestant of the show and that’s why for her splendid performance and strength the creators announced her as a winner of the show.

Roadies Season 11 Winner Name 2014 (Ride for Respect): Nikhil Sachdeva

The eleventh season’s first episode was aired on 25th January 2014 and after lots of hard work and effort, the show comes to an end on 18th May 2014 where the anchor announced Nikhil Sachdeva as the winner of the show.

Roadies Season 12 Winner Name 2015 (Your Road, Your Gang): Prince Narula

The twelfth season was won by Prince Narula, and the show’s first episode was aired on 27th June 2015. The winner of the show collects the prize money of Rs. 5 Lakh along with a brand new Hero Karizma ZMR bike but the winner of the show gives the bike to the runner-up of the show name Gurmeet.

Roadies Season 14 Winner Name 2016 (Your Gang, Your Glory): Balraj Khera

After the huge success of the 12th season, the creators come with the thirteenth season with the brand new title of Roadies X4: Your Gang, Your Glory. In this season, the contestant who gets the trophy of the season was Balraj Khera and he wins the show with Renault Duster and lots of prize money.

Roadies Season 15 Winner Name 2017 (Roadies Rising): Shweta Mehta

After the ending of the 14th season, the 15th season comes with new judges and a new tagline on 8th April 2017, where the participant Shweta Mehta grabs the winning trophy and she was in the team of Neha Dhupia’s gang. The show was hosted by Gaelyn Mendonca along with the gang leaders of Karan Kundra, Neha Dhupia, Prince Narula, and cricketer Harbhajan Singh.

Roadies Season 16 Winner Name 2018 (Roadies Xtreme): Kashish Thakur Pundir

The 15th season emerged as a super hit, and for continuing the hype of the show, the creators come back with the 16th season with the incredible title of “Roadies Xtreme “, where the contestant Kashish Thakur Pundir holds first place and grabs the trophy of the season, and again the Neha Dhupia’s gang member wins the show.

Roadies Season 17 Winner Name 2019` (Roadies Real Heroes): Arun Sharma

The 17th season was won by the contestant named Arun Sharma, who win the amazing title of the show named Roadies Real Heroes but this time Raftaar’s gang member grab the season trophy.
